Working Principles

The MCP6022T-E/ST is an operational amplifier that amplifies and conditions signals in electronic circuits. It operates by taking the difference between the voltages at its two input terminals (Vin+) and (Vin-) and amplifying this difference to produce an output voltage. The amplified output can be used for various purposes such as filtering, amplification, or signal conditioning.
